Providing support during times of emergency
The Neighbourhood Hub provides emergency relief, support and resources to the Mackay community.
Community Connect workers are based in Neighbourhood Centres to support to individuals and families with complex needs. This service helps link people to community and specialist support services, through referrals and tailored support.
The Emergency Relief Program provides emergency relief in the form of food hampers or fuel vouchers on a case by case basis.
This is a free weekly event where community members can access a meal, collect food donations, connect with other local Mackay community members as well as receive assistance with referral information.
With the support of Coles and Woolworths we have food donations available Monday to Friday.
